€20 to pay with a visa card as that is the only way to pay?

As has been mentioned countless times on here, and is pointed out on ryanair.com, the Visa Electron card doesn't incur a fee.
Why should a predominantly internet based business accept payment by cheque when most retailers in the UK no longer recognise them as a form of payment? Why should I, as a consumer, incur additional costs relating to the processing of cheques, that a minority would choose to pay with?

You've chosen to check in one piece of hold baggage, no one is forcing you to. Again, why should I, a consumer who travels on most occasions with hand baggage only, subsidise passengers who wish to take hold baggage (incurring the airline more costs)?
